The AFLC was founded in 2013 by Chris McLaurin, [2] a former football player for the University of Michigan Wolverines.McLaurin, working in Chongqing at the time, helped to organize a group of locals and expatriates who were interested in football into the Chongqing Dockers, whose first season was profiled by the New Republic in The Year of the Pigskin. Long Ding (born February 11, 1988) is a Chinese college athlete who plays American football as kicker. He was originally a member of the IFAF / USA Football International Student Program, [ 1 ] before entering college football after his arrival in the United States in 2007.

Ed Wang was the first full-blooded Chinese player to both be drafted and to play in the NFL [18] after the AFL–NFL merger, Edward was a former American football offensive tackle and played college football at Virginia Tech and was drafted by the Buffalo Bills in the 2010 NFL Draft.

Peizhang Jackson He (Chinese: 何佩璋; pinyin: Hé Pèizhāng) is a Chinese former American football running back. He played college football for the Arizona State Sun Devils. He became the first Chinese-born player to play for a Power Five conference team when he appeared in a game against the UCLA Bruins on December 5, 2020. [2]

International athletes have played in the NFL since the league's founding in 1920. There have been 9 foreign-born players inducted into the Pro Football Hall of Fame.
